Technical Analysis

The provided information pertains to CVE-2025-4974, which is classified as a vulnerability. However, the entry lacks any technical details, description, affected versions, or patch information. The CVE record is marked with a state of 'REJECTED' by the assigner 'GitLab', indicating that this CVE identifier was reserved but ultimately rejected and not assigned to a valid vulnerability. There are no known exploits in the wild, no CWE identifiers, and no indicators of compromise or attack vectors provided. Without any technical details or evidence of an actual security flaw, this entry does not represent an active or confirmed security threat or vulnerability. The absence of a CVSS score and the rejection status further support that this is not a valid or exploitable vulnerability.
